if you work with MariaDB and you wanted to spare a while to test the new 10.2.10 version, which is currently in rawhide, I'd appreciate it!

I made changes to the RPM layout, so some plugins were detached from the main server package.
Also, the MariaDB shared library now do reside in libdir, instead of libdir/mariadb, false provides has been removed and Cmake argumets has to be updated - which all could cause some unwanted effect I couldn't imagine.
Also, I'd like to know, if the https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=1514820 is reproducible for you.

Some of you (users) reported, they had a hard time updating from f26->f27 because MDB was not starting. That is caused by location update of PID file () , so custom server config files could need update.
